Ratepayers’ meeting

An association for concerned residents and ratepayers of Kaiapoi may be formed at a public meeting in the Anglican hall on Friday, November 18 at 7.30 p.m. Mrs R. Wade, as spokesman for a group of seven interested persons, said the proposal had already met considerable verbarsupport. The aim of the meeting was to see if Kaiapoi needed such an organisation. The group felt that Kaiapoi people should be made aware and be able to voice an opinion on matters of concern. Such an organisation could be a watchdog within the community. If the meeting was agreeable, a name and a small . subscription to cover expenses would be settled. A chairman would be needed and a group of perhaps about eight to keep in close communication with the Borough Council.
